SUMMARY:Cotswold Sculptors Indoor Exhibition
DESCRIPTION:As part of this year’s Autumn Trail\, the Cotswold Sculptors Association invite visitors to a special exhibition to be held Saturday 18th October-Sunday 26th October inclusive (CLOSED MONDAYS) \nYou’ll be able to explore a wonderful variety of sculptures from 48 of our member-artists\, working in a range of mediums such as bronze\, ceramics\, stone\, wood\, metal and found materials. Some focus on figurative subjects such as people\, animals and nature\, whilst other pieces are more abstract. \nThe exhibition is free to enjoy and you’ll be able to buy refreshments on site from the Long Table. There is parking on site but please use public transport or lift sharing\, if you can. Kids are very welcome but there will be delicate works on show so please help them take care. \nSpecial demo day: Saturday 25th October \nVisit on this day to see and interact with some of our artists whose work is featured in the exhibition. \nMany sculptures will be available to buy either as unique pieces or limited special editions. 15% of sales go to The Long Table. \nThe Cotswold Sculptors are a not-for-profit collective of mainly local artists\, coming together to share our passion for sculpture. SUMMARY:Cotteswold Naturalists Field Club:  Lost Birds of Gloucestershire
DESCRIPTION:Please note\, our original speaker\, Andy Lewis\, is unable to give his talk on Bird Migration because of family illness. \nAndrew Bluett has taken his place and will talk about some of the bird species we had pre- and post-WW2 which were lost during the 1950s and ‘60s.  Andrew will consider some of the reasons for their disappearance.   Andrew is a Trustee at the Museum in the Park\, Stroud and a long-standing officer with the Gloucestershire Naturalists’ Society. \n\n2.15 for 2.30 p.m. start. \nContribution of £5 from visitors is requested. Followed by refreshments at no additional charge. \nLimited free parking at Village Hall. Additional parking available on the common. \n\n  \n
